Why Poplar Homes
We’re revolutionizing real estate by connecting investors & homeowners to dependable residents without the marketing or day to day management hassles. We make owning a rental home easier and more profitable through our innovative technology, risk reduction measures and local full-service management support. Renters benefit from better responsiveness to requests and a unique program that provides a pathway to home ownership. We operate in 15 markets with over 14,000 doors under our management. Our teams coordinate with over 35,000 owners and residents. We’re a well-established startup poised for even more incredible growth and looking for more highly capable, curious, entrepreneurial and adaptable sales professionals to help contribute.
We are looking for an Employee Change Management Specialist responsible for coordination of organizational change activities as part of the integration program. As a key strategy of our continued growth, Poplar Homes is actively acquiring companies within the long term rental industry. You will deliver strategies and plans to prioritize acquired employees and maximize the adoption of Poplar Homes processes. To be successful as an Employee Change Management Specialist at Poplar Homes, you will implement a strategy that supports Operational growth and sets acquired employees and local Operations up to begin operating immediately post integration.
Roles and Responsibilities:
- Implement the employee engagement and communication strategy
- Conduct impact analyses, assess change readiness, and identify key employees
- Implement the strategy to support adoption of changes during the integration period
- Provide input, document requirements and support the design and delivery of training for acquired employees
- Support and engage Operation Leadership on hiring of acquired employees
- Identify and manage anticipated risks and create tactics to mitigate
- Define and measure success metrics
Key Skills and Requirements:
- Ability to develop and maintain str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ders
- Familiarity with project management approaches, tools and phases of the project lifecycle
- A solid understanding of how people go through change and the change process
- Previous experience in managing, leading and building teams
- Experience with and knowledge of change management principles, methodologies and tools
- Change management certification or designation desired
- Able to work effectively at all levels of an organization
- Bachelor’s Degree in business, HR, Organizational Development or related field
- Flexible and adaptable; able to work in ambiguous situations
- The ability to work on multiple projects at the same time
- 3+ years of experience in organizational change management program design and implementation
- Organized with an inclination for planning strategy and tactics
